What youll do Lead housing managers to deliver safe, well run estates and communities.

Supporting our Housing Managers across Essex to improve services for customers and communities.

Act as escalation point for complex ASB, safeguarding, and tenancy cases.

Attend customer visits and community events to stay connected to local neighbourhoods and build positive relationships.

Work hands on with customers to resolve issues and improve neighbourhoods.

Use insight and quality checks to drive consistent performance and income.

Build strong relationships with partners, councils, and local stakeholders.

You have You have strong housing management experience or equivalent practical knowledge.

You have led, coached, or supported housing teams to improve performance.

You have confidence handling ASB, safeguarding, and complex customer issues.

You have good knowledge of housing law, estates, and tenancy management.

You have resilience, empathy, and clear judgement when things get challenging.

The practical bits You'll work across Essex, including Saffron Walden, Canvey Island, Brentwood, Colchester and Chelmsford.

You'll spend around 2 days each week out in the community the rest working from home or popping into our regional offices.

You need an Enhanced with barring list DBS check (we pay) You need to be able to drive and have access to your own vehicle insured for business purposes

Whats in it for you? 34 days leave, rising to 39 (this includes bank holidays and a me day) and the option to buy 5 more each year 2 paid volunteering days each year Matching pension contribution (up to 7% and life insurance of 3x basic salary) 800+ discounts on shops, holidays, days out, tech and more Family friendly policies including maternity, paternity, adoption, neonatal, fertility and menopause support
